The value of Howard Hodgkin's Venice, Afternoon (signed) is estimated to be worth between £4,050 and £6,000. This intaglio print, created in 1995, has shown consistent value growth since its first sale in March 2005. Over the past 12 months, the artwork has sold twice, with an average selling price of £4,034. In the last five years, the hammer price has ranged from £3,813 in April 2025 to £8,000 in April 2021. The current average annual growth rate is -8%. This work is part of a limited edition of 60.
